Intrigued in growing food to buy in the City of Chicago? Thinking regarding beginning an area garden? Adjustments to the Chicago Zoning Regulation permit agricultural uses like neighborhood yards and metropolitan ranches in many parts of the city. Below is a list of often asked questions relating to the regulations and policies that farmers ought to take into consideration when planning a city agriculture project.


The zoning modification does not modify any various other codes dealing with composting, structure licenses, buying or renting City had property, service licenses or ecological contamination. There are existing codes that manage these concerns and they stay completely result and might apply to your task. Area yards are generally owned or managed by public entities, civic companies or community-based companies and maintained by volunteers.


Urban farms expand food that is planned to be marketed, either on a not-for-profit or for-profit basis. Because of their business objective, city farms call for a company permit. Yes. An area garden is permitted to market surplus generate that was grown on site if the sales are accessory or subservient to the yard's key purpose explained above.

Composting is permitted however just for plant material that is produced and used on site. The amount of compost product can not exceed 25 cubic yards at any kind of offered time according to the criteria in 7-28-715 of the City's Municipal Code. Yes. Due to the fact that the dirt at many new yard websites requires changing, garden compost, soil, timber chips, or various other materials can be gotten to build or enhance the growing space - garden care.

Approval of food scraps or other waste goes beyond the intended purpose of a neighborhood yard. Neighborhood yard device structures might be up to 575 square feet in area.


If a structure license is needed after that the hoophouse will be taken into consideration an accessory building. You can discover even more regarding the structure authorization demands by calling the Department of Structures. The 25,000-square-foot dimension limitation is meant to stop a solitary community garden from dominating a given block or detracting from the block's existing domestic or business character.


The limit does not relate to gardens found in Public Open Room (POS) areas. Can there be even more than one neighborhood yard that is 25,000 square feet on a solitary block? Yes. The size limit relates to specific gardens, not to specific blocks. No. Fencing is not needed, however, gardens that have huge parking lot might be required to mount fence or other landscaping functions.

B1 & B2 areas call for that all commercial usage tasks be performed inside. Is secure fencing needed for city farms? Fencings may be required, along with landscaping and testing, for certain parking areas and outdoor job or storage locations depending on place and the specific activity taking location.




Yes. Urban farms require structure permits and zoning authorizations prior to building. Various other forms of city evaluation may be needed depending on particular frameworks, activities, size, landscaping, licensing, public heath and stormwater administration concerns. A lot of these requirements are recognized in the task design or permitting procedure, however, the applicant may be liable to independently recognize certain licenses or permits that might be needed.


The Division of Company Matters and Customer Defense can aid figure out the certain kind of service license that's needed. Off road car park is required for a lot of commercial projects in Chicago. The needed number of car park areas is based on the number of employees functioning on website and not the square video footage of the expanding space.

Urban farms are allowed on rooftops in suitable zoning areas. The approval of food scraps or landscape waste is thought about a waste dealing with go right here usage by the Chicago Municipal Code.


A city farm can offer garden compost product generated on site, nonetheless, the procedure must comply with the guidelines in 7-28-715 of the Chicago Municipal Code. Aquaponic systems are permitted inside your home on city farms in several zoning districts.


As much as five hives or colonies of honey may be kept as an accessory usage. Nonetheless, beekeepers should register with the Illinois Division of Farming. Farming in cities and city locations A city farm in Chicago. Urban farming refers to various practices of growing. https://forums.hostsearch.com/member.php?263116-cityblooming, processing, and dispersing food in urban locations. The term also applies to the area activities of pet husbandry, tank farming, beekeeping, and gardening in an urban context. Urban agriculture is differentiated from peri-urban agriculture, which occurs in rural locations at the side of suburban areas.
